The Honorary Doctorate: A Prestigious Recognition of Academic Excellence
Unlike an earned doctoral degree awarded upon the completion of advanced study and original research, an Honorary Doctorate (Honoris Causa) is one of the highest academic distinctions conferred by universities to recognize individuals who have demonstrated exceptional achievements and made significant contributions to education, scientific advancement, innovation, leadership, or society.
Across the world, honorary doctorates have long been awarded by leading universities to celebrate distinguished scholars, scientists, innovators, and global leaders whose work has generated lasting impact beyond academia.

Professor Charl de Villiers – A World-Renowned Scholar Among the Top 2% Scientists Globally
Behind every prestigious academic distinction lies a lifetime dedicated to the pursuit of knowledge.
With more than four decades of distinguished contributions to higher education and scientific research, Professor Charl de Villiers has established himself as one of the world's leading scholars in accounting, corporate governance, sustainability, and integrated reporting.
His remarkable academic achievements include:
- More than 40 years of dedication to research and higher education.
- Over 500 internationally published research papers and scholarly publications.
- More than 120 articles published in Q1 journals, representing the highest-ranked journals in their respective disciplines.
- More than 20,000 citations, reflecting the global impact of his research.
- Recognition among the World's Top 2% Most Influential Scientists, acknowledging his outstanding contributions to international scholarship.

Professor Charl de Villiers is internationally recognized not only for his prolific research output but also for his pioneering work in sustainability accounting, integrated reporting, corporate governance, and corporate social responsibility. His research has significantly influenced contemporary academic thought while providing valuable insights for policymakers, businesses, and higher education institutions worldwide.
